系统修改报告入门指南:从零开始掌握核心要点
在数字化转型的浪潮中,系统修改报告作为保障业务连续性与技术迭代的关键文档,正成为IT从业者与企业管理者的必备技能。一份高质量的系统修改报告,不仅能清晰记录系统变更的来龙去脉,更能为后续维护、审计与优化提供坚实依据。本文将从基础概念、核心原理、入门步骤、常见误区与学习路径五个维度,带你从零开始掌握系统修改报告的核心要点。
一、基础概念:系统修改报告的本质与价值
1.1 系统修改报告的定义
系统修改报告是一种用于记录、描述和沟通系统变更过程的正式文档。它涵盖了从变更需求提出、方案设计、实施执行到测试验证的全流程信息,旨在确保所有相关方对系统修改的内容、原因、影响与结果达成共识。无论是软件开发中的功能迭代,还是企业IT系统的日常维护,系统修改报告都扮演着“变更说明书”与“操作手册”的双重角色。
1.2 系统修改报告的核心价值
- 风险管控:通过明确修改范围、潜在风险与应对措施,提前识别并规避系统变更可能引发的业务中断、数据丢失等问题。
- 知识沉淀:记录系统修改的技术细节与经验教训,形成可复用的知识库,降低团队成员流动带来的知识断层风险。
- 合规审计:满足企业内部审计与行业监管要求,为系统变更提供可追溯的证据链。
- 协同效率:统一团队沟通语言,减少因信息不对称导致的误解与返工,提升跨部门协作效率。
二、核心原理:系统修改报告的底层逻辑
2.1 变更管理流程
系统修改报告的核心逻辑源于变更管理流程,其本质是对“谁在什么时间、为什么、如何修改了系统的哪一部分”这一问题的系统性回答。完整的变更管理流程通常包括以下环节:
- 需求提出:由业务部门或技术团队发起系统修改请求,明确变更的背景、目标与预期效果。
- 评估审批:由变更管理委员会(CAB)对变更请求进行技术可行性、业务影响与风险评估,决定是否批准实施。
- 方案设计:根据审批结果,制定详细的修改方案,包括技术选型、实施步骤、测试计划与回滚策略。
- 执行实施:按照方案完成系统修改,并记录实施过程中的关键节点与异常情况。
- 测试验证:对修改后的系统进行功能测试、性能测试与安全测试,确保变更达到预期目标且未引入新的问题。
- 文档更新:更新系统相关文档,包括系统修改报告、用户手册、架构图等,保持文档与实际系统的一致性。
2.2 信息完整性原则
一份合格的系统修改报告应遵循信息完整性原则,确保涵盖以下关键要素:
- 基本信息:报告编号、修改版本、报告日期、编制人、审核人等元数据。
- 变更背景:系统修改的起因、业务需求或技术驱动因素。
- 修改内容:具体修改的功能模块、代码文件、配置项等,以及修改前后的差异对比。
- 实施过程:修改的时间节点、执行人员、使用的工具与技术、遇到的问题及解决方案。
- 测试结果:测试用例、测试数据、测试结论与缺陷修复情况。
- 风险评估:修改可能带来的业务风险、技术风险与安全风险,以及对应的防范措施。
- 回滚策略:若修改失败,如何快速恢复到修改前的系统状态。
三、入门步骤:从零开始撰写系统修改报告
3.1 步骤一:明确报告目标与受众
在撰写系统修改报告前,首先要明确报告的目标与受众。不同的受众对报告的关注点与深度要求不同:
- 技术团队:关注修改的技术细节、代码实现与性能影响,需要详细的技术文档与测试数据。
- 业务部门:关注修改对业务流程、用户体验与业务指标的影响,需要通俗易懂的业务说明与效果展示。
- 管理层:关注修改的投入产出比、风险管控与战略价值,需要简洁的摘要与决策建议。
3.2 步骤二:收集与整理变更信息
系统修改报告的质量取决于信息收集的全面性与准确性。在撰写前,需收集以下信息:
- 变更请求文档:包括需求说明书、变更申请表等,明确修改的背景与目标。
- 技术设计文档:如架构图、流程图、数据库设计文档等,了解系统的原有结构与修改的技术方案。
- 实施记录:包括开发日志、测试报告、配置变更记录等,记录修改的具体过程与结果。
- 相关人员访谈:与开发人员、测试人员、业务分析师等沟通,获取第一手的信息与经验。
3.3 步骤三:构建报告框架
根据信息完整性原则,构建系统修改报告的基本框架。以下是一个通用的报告框架示例:
- 封面:报告标题、编号、版本、日期、编制单位等。
- 目录:列出报告的章节与页码。
- 摘要:简要介绍报告的核心内容、修改目标与主要结论。
- 变更背景:阐述系统修改的起因、业务需求与技术驱动因素。
- 修改内容:详细描述修改的功能模块、代码文件、配置项等,可采用表格、图表等形式进行对比展示。
- 实施过程:按照时间顺序记录修改的执行步骤、关键节点与异常情况。
- 测试结果:展示测试用例、测试数据与测试结论,说明修改是否达到预期目标。
- 风险评估与应对:分析修改可能带来的风险,并提出相应的防范措施与回滚策略。
- 结论与建议:总结修改的成果与经验,提出后续优化建议。
- 附录:包括相关文档的引用、测试报告的详细内容、代码变更记录等。
3.4 步骤四:撰写报告内容
在撰写报告内容时,需注意以下几点:
- 语言简洁明了:避免使用过于专业的术语与复杂的句子结构,确保不同背景的读者都能理解。
- 数据支撑:尽可能使用具体的数据、图表与案例来支撑观点,增强报告的说服力。
- 逻辑清晰:按照“提出问题-分析问题-解决问题”的逻辑顺序组织内容,确保报告结构严谨、层次分明。
- 重点突出:根据受众需求,突出报告的核心内容,避免无关信息的堆砌。
3.5 步骤五:审核与修订
报告初稿完成后,需提交给相关人员进行审核。审核的重点包括:
- 信息准确性:检查报告中的数据、事实与技术细节是否准确无误。
- 逻辑合理性:评估报告的结构是否清晰、逻辑是否严谨、结论是否合理。
- 合规性:确保报告符合企业内部文档规范与行业监管要求。
- 可读性:检查报告的语言表达是否流畅、易懂,是否存在错别字与语法错误。
根据审核意见,对报告进行修订,直至达到最终的质量要求。
四、常见误区:避免系统修改报告撰写的陷阱
4.1 误区一:重形式轻内容
部分从业者过于追求报告的格式美观,而忽视了内容的实质性价值。一份好的系统修改报告应首先保证内容的完整性与准确性,其次才是格式的规范性。过度注重形式而忽略内容,会导致报告成为“花瓶”,无法发挥其应有的作用。
4.2 误区二:事后补写报告
很多团队在系统修改完成后才开始撰写报告,此时往往会因为记忆模糊或信息丢失导致报告内容不完整、不准确。正确的做法是在变更管理流程的每个环节同步记录相关信息,确保报告内容的及时性与真实性。
4.3 误区三:忽略风险评估
部分报告对系统修改可能带来的风险避而不谈或一笔带过,导致企业在面对突发问题时束手无策。在撰写报告时,应全面评估修改的潜在风险,并制定详细的应对措施与回滚策略,确保系统变更的安全性。
4.4 误区四:报告与实际不符
由于文档更新不及时,部分系统修改报告与实际系统状态存在差异,导致报告失去参考价值。为避免这一问题,应建立文档更新机制,确保报告内容与系统修改同步更新。
五、学习路径:系统掌握系统修改报告撰写技能
5.1 阶段一:基础知识学习
- 变更管理理论:学习变更管理的基本概念、流程与方法,了解ITIL、COBIT等国际标准中关于变更管理的最佳实践。
- 文档规范:熟悉企业内部文档规范与行业通用的文档格式,掌握文档编写的基本技巧。
- 系统架构知识:了解所在企业的系统架构、技术栈与业务流程,为撰写系统修改报告奠定基础。
5.2 阶段二:实践操作
- 案例分析:研读优秀的系统修改报告案例,分析其结构、内容与写作技巧,学习他人的经验与方法。
- 模拟撰写:选择一个实际的系统修改项目,按照报告框架与要求进行模拟撰写,锻炼文档编写能力。
- 团队协作:参与团队的变更管理流程,协助编制系统修改报告,在实践中积累经验。
5.3 阶段三:进阶提升
- 风险评估能力:学习风险评估的方法与工具,提升对系统修改潜在风险的识别与应对能力。
- 沟通协调能力:加强与业务部门、技术团队与管理层的沟通,提高跨部门协作效率与报告的针对性。
- 持续改进:定期对已完成的系统修改报告进行复盘总结,分析存在的问题与不足,不断优化报告撰写流程与质量。
六、结尾
系统修改报告作为系统变更管理的重要组成部分,其价值不仅在于记录过去,更在于指导未来。通过掌握系统修改报告的基础概念、核心原理与撰写技巧,你将能够为企业的数字化转型提供有力的支持,成为一名合格的IT从业者。希望本文能为你开启系统修改报告学习之旅提供有益的帮助,让我们在实践中不断成长,共同推动企业系统的持续优化与创新。